Description
Delightful cookies embodying the bright and refreshing flavor of lemons, featuring a chewy texture and beautiful powdered sugar coating.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1/3 cup vegetable oil
- 1 large egg
- 1 tablespoon lemon zest
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- Pow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Combine the sugar and vegetable oil in a mixing bowl. Mix well until creamy.
- Add the egg, lemon zest, and lemon juice, mixing until smooth and blended.
- Wh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a separate bowl.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
- Scoop tablespoon-sized balls of dough and roll in powdered sugar to coat completely.
- Place the dough balls on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, spaced about 2 inches apart.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are set but the centers remain soft.
- C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Notes
For the best flavor, always use fresh lemons. Avoid overmixing to keep cookies soft and chewy.
